Minutes — Orvane Retail Group management meeting, Kellsmoor office. Attendees reviewed the Orvane Rewards overhaul. Sales leads should note: tier thresholds will be recalibrated before launch, legacy points honoured for six months, and pilot branches in Aldbeck report strong early uptake. Marketing collateral is pending sign-off from Priya Halden. The confidential business-plan note is appended directly below for restricted circulation.

confidential, kagep-kahof: Druokax Systems plans to lower the Ulaath list price by 53 percent in March.

Check that implement identifiers, GPS fixes, and hour-meter readings are range-checked, that malformed frames are quarantined rather than dropped silently, and that quarantine counters surface in the plugin health endpoint. Confirm replay protection on the CAN-bus bridge is enabled in all deployed configurations. Record evidence for each check, then obtain sign-off from the accountable gateway owner, whose full name appears below.

signatory, tajof-yaweg: Ralix Istdor

## Artifact signing — Graphlet

Quick note for the eng sync: Graphlet (our dependency graph visualizer) now ships signed artifacts only. The CI step at Norbeck signs each tarball post-build, and the install script verifies before unpacking, so unsigned nightlies will flat-out refuse to install. If verification fails, don't bypass it — rebuild instead. For local verification, use the current signing key shown below.

rollout seal: bky4_x7Gc